65 Perm Engine Manufacturers Received Honorary Awards and Certificates of Inclusion on the Recognition Board

09.06.2023

On the birthday of UEC-Perm Engines (a part of Rostec United Engine Corporation), a gala night for engine manufacturers and veterans of the company took place at Soldatov House of Culture, dedicated to the 89th anniversary of the founding of the plant. At the event, awards named after Mikhail Subbotin, Alexander Pavlikov, and Dmitry Dicheskul were presented, and thirty best workers, whose names will be on the Recognition Board of the plant, were announced.

Speaking to the audience, Sergey Kharin, Executive Director of UEC-Perm Engines, congratulated the labor collective of the plant and emphasized that Perm engines are the pride and glory of Russia. “The biggest engine plant of the country remains a leader among all manufacturers of gas-turbine equipment for the oil and natural gas industry as well as for the power industry. The plant increases the production of PS-90A aero-engines and launches the serial production of PD-14 engine for the national medium-range MC-21-310 aircraft. The country needs our products at all times. Its quality and reliability are ensured by dedicated work of thousands of workers and engineers, the best of whom are being awarded honorary prizes today”, said S. Kharin.

The award named after Mikhail Subbotin, the legendary director of the engine plant from 1965 to 1973, is awarded for effective management of the manufacturing department. One of ten awardees is Maxim Panin, foreman of shop 14. He began his career at the company in 2007 as a monitoring and metering instrument fitter. After 12 years, he was appointed as a job foreman. Maxim Panin is a multiple participant and winner of the Factory professional skill competitions. The experienced mentor is now studying at the Perm College of Industrial and Information Technologies in the specialty “Mechanical Engineering Technology”.

The award named after Alexander Pavlikov, Hero of Socialist Labor and highly qualified vertical lathe operator, who worked at Perm Engines for 47 years, was presented to fifteen best workers for zero-defects production and great work contribution to the development of the enterprise. One of them is Evgeny Borshnyakov, vacuum coating operator of shop 38. After joining the plant 25 years ago as an electrician, Evgeny has mastered a new profession, was placed in the sixth rank, and now works on self-monitoring and produces consistently high quality products.

Ten plant workers were awarded the prize named after Dmitry Dicheskul, Hero of Socialist Labor, and Chief Engineer of the plant from 1961 to 1981. This award is given to the employees of the company for special achievements in their professional activities, implementation of high-tech solutions in production. Among the laureates is Alexey Vdovkin, leading specialist of general utilities of the office of the Chief Power Engineer. His developments on modernization of the motor control center allowed increasing the service life of equipment and resulted in considerable saving of energy resources. Alexey is one of those specialists who today successfully solve the most complex engineering challenges.

The gala night continued with a concert, which featured performances by pop stars, winners of the factory creative competition “On takeoff!” and creative teams of Prikamye region.
